Output eda801677415311e81de63f16721b8312b22f659833a79bc9dc6868649b6131a:1

value
4189035760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e284e2c52fe3ae61f693049a4817ba24bb7a31 OP_EQUAL
address
2N2SevHiJbhR2dDiiduwwS1gt9GruegaJWH
transaction
eda801677415311e81de63f16721b8312b22f659833a79bc9dc6868649b6131a